mboost-dp1

Hjælp til setup af Netbeans C/C++ -compiler !urgent!


Gå til bund
Gravatar #1 - Qw_freak
23. maj 2010 13:15
hey, jeg kann ikke få Cygwin compileren sat op i netbeans, hvilke filer skal jeg vælge fra Cygwin\bin\ mappen til de forskellige options:

C compiler :
C++ compiler :
Fortran compiler :
Assembler :
Make command :
Debugger Command :
Qmake command :
Cmake command :

Hvilke filer skal jeg vælge fra Cygwin\bin mappen?
Gravatar #2 - arne_v
23. maj 2010 13:27
#1

gcc.exe (*)
g++.exe (*)
g77.exe (*)
as.exe
make.exe
gdb.exe
?
cmake.exe

*) Jeg antager at du vil have compiler driver ikke den rå compiler som kører mellem pre-processor og assembler.

Gravatar #3 - Qw_freak
23. maj 2010 13:40
jeg forstå det ikke, de filer er der ikke i bin mappen! :(
Gravatar #4 - arne_v
23. maj 2010 13:47
#3

Cygwin er komponent/modul baseret.

Selve cygwin er bare en lille bitte del. Så kan man installere GCC og flere tusind andre stumper.

Hvad har du installeret?
Gravatar #5 - Qw_freak
23. maj 2010 14:00
jeg har bare kørt setup.exe fra cygwin, og jeg tror da jeg har valgt full install.
Jeg bliver mødt med dette vindue når jeg installerer, så trykker jeg bare next!
Gravatar #6 - onetreehell
23. maj 2010 14:03
#5
Prøv at undersøge hvad du har checked under mingw (svjh så er det der gcc ligger).

Ellers kan du overveje at installere et *nix i en virtual machine.
Gravatar #7 - arne_v
23. maj 2010 14:09
#6

mingw != cygwin
Gravatar #8 - arne_v
23. maj 2010 14:10
#5

Vi behøver flere detaljer.
Gravatar #9 - Qw_freak
23. maj 2010 14:14
skal jeg ekspande i valgvinduet?

Er det kun MinGW jeg skal være sikker på installerer?

Jeg kan se at alt i MinGW var disablet, så jeg har enablet dem!
Gravatar #10 - Qw_freak
23. maj 2010 15:06
jeg har fået compileren op at køre, så er mit næste problem bare at da jeg laver en Hello World, compiler den også fint, men så beder netbeans bare om at åbne en .SH fil og intet andet sker!??

burde der ikke komme en .exe fil ud af det?? hvis ikke, hvor kan jeg ændre i det så det er .exze filer jeg får lavet?
Gravatar #11 - arne_v
23. maj 2010 16:55
#9

Hvis du vil have mingw, så drop cygwin og download mingw direkte.

Mit foretrukne mingw download sted idag er:

http://www.equation.com/servlet/equation.cmd?fa=fo...
Gravatar #12 - arne_v
23. maj 2010 16:55
#10

Hvis den compiler fint, så har du vel også en EXE fil et sted??
Gravatar #13 - KC
23. maj 2010 17:44
Er jeg den eneste som læser dette, somom problemet IKKE haster?

!urgent!
Gravatar #14 - Qw_freak
23. maj 2010 18:51
Det haster en hel del, har et helt program jeg skal have skrevet og dokumenteret til på fredag, og mon ikke i kan læse at jeg ikke har helt styr på det!???

#12
jeg kan ikke finde den, når jeg compiler det welcome-program der er med i netbeans prøver en fil kaldet: DOOPEN.sh at åbnes, og i debug mappen ligger der kun en welcome.o fil!
edit: jeg har prøvet at åbne filen gennem cmd.exe, men den viser bare directoriet!
Gravatar #15 - onetreehell
23. maj 2010 19:48
#14
.o-filer plejer at være objekt-filer. Det betyder at du ikke (umiddelbart) kan eksekvere den. Den skal igennem en linker først, svjh.

Hvad er det for en opgave?

Kan du evt. åbne DOOPEN.sh i en teksteditor og fortælle hvad der står?

EDIT:
Jeg vil desuden anbefale dig at bruge en almindelig tekst-editor med syntax highlighting og basal indentering i stedet for netbeans til at begynde med.
Gravatar #16 - arne_v
23. maj 2010 19:55
#14

welcome.o kan linke stil welcome.exe, men det burde IDE'em gøre.
Gravatar #17 - arne_v
23. maj 2010 19:56
#15

Jep. Kode i standard editor (notepad++/UltraEDit/JEdit/whatever) og command line compile (f.eks. med den MinGW jeg linkede til tidligere) eller finde en nemmere IDE som f.eks. dev-cpp var nok mere produktivt.
Gravatar #18 - Spiderboy
23. maj 2010 19:58
Måske har han ikke angivet linkeren i hans IDE-settings.

Det er lang tid siden jeg har sat NetBeans op til C++, men så vidt jeg husker installerede jeg blot MinGW, derefter NetBeans, sørgede for at den havde C++ plugins'ene og så angav MinGW-programmerne derinde et sted, og så funkede det. Kan desværre ikke huske detaljerne.

#17
Ja, Dev-cpp er en mulighed hvis han er villig til at bruge en anden IDE. Der er en bundle med compiler i, hvor alt er sat op og kører out of the box.
Gravatar #19 - Qw_freak
23. maj 2010 19:59
Spiderboy (18) skrev:
Ja, Dev-cpp er en mulighed hvis han er villig til at bruge en anden IDE. Der er en bundle med compiler i, hvor alt er sat op og kører out of the box.


kan jeg også skrive c-prog i det?
Gravatar #20 - Spiderboy
23. maj 2010 20:00
Det er virkelig lang tid siden jeg har brugt Dev-cpp (foretrækker NetBeans), men det mener jeg godt man kan, ja.
Gravatar #21 - arne_v
23. maj 2010 21:48
#19

dev-cpp kan kun lave C og C++.

(NetBeans er til Java, C/C++, Python etc.)

NetBeans er et prof stykke værktøj.

dev-cpp er et legetøj til undervisning.

Men man bør kunne installere dev-cpp og lave hello world på 5-10 minutter.
Gå til top

Opret dig som bruger i dag

Det er gratis, og du binder dig ikke til noget.

Når du er oprettet som bruger, får du adgang til en lang række af sidens andre muligheder, såsom at udforme siden efter eget ønske og deltage i diskussionerne.

Opret Bruger Login